Understanding Hurricane Isaac's Projected Path

When we talk about Hurricane Isaac's path, we're essentially referring to the forecast of where the center of the storm is expected to go over time. This is a dynamic prediction, constantly updated by meteorologists at the National Hurricane Center (NHC) and other reputable sources. The path is not a single line; rather, it’s a cone of uncertainty. This cone represents the probable track of the storm center, and it gets wider the further out the forecast goes. Think of it like this: the further you try to predict, the more uncertain things become. The cone of uncertainty incorporates the historical errors of previous forecasts. So, if the forecast is for a hurricane to make landfall in three days, the cone will be wider than if the forecast is for landfall tomorrow. The cone doesn't show the size of the storm itself, nor does it indicate the area that will experience hurricane-force winds. That's why it's so important to pay close attention to the wind, storm surge, and rainfall forecasts as well. The NHC and other weather agencies use sophisticated computer models, historical data, and observational data from satellites, aircraft reconnaissance, and surface-based instruments to create these forecasts. These models consider a range of factors, including atmospheric pressure, wind patterns, sea surface temperatures, and the storm's past behavior. The models generate multiple potential paths, which are then analyzed by meteorologists who use their expertise to create the official forecast track. This track is the most likely path the storm will take, but it's important to remember that it's still a prediction, and the storm could deviate from it. The potential for the storm to change direction, speed up, slow down, or intensify all contribute to the uncertainty in the forecast. It is essential to stay updated with the latest advisories from the NHC and local emergency management agencies for the most accurate and up-to-date information on the storm's path and potential impacts. These advisories provide critical details about the storm's location, intensity, and projected path, along with warnings and watches for specific areas that could be affected.

The Cone of Uncertainty Explained

The cone of uncertainty, as mentioned earlier, is a key element in understanding the forecast for Hurricane Isaac's path. It's a visual representation of the potential track of the storm's center, illustrating the probable area where the center of the hurricane might move. The width of the cone increases over time to reflect the growing uncertainty inherent in forecasting. Think of it as a safety margin – the further into the future the forecast goes, the wider the margin becomes. This is because the further out the forecast, the more variables and potential changes can affect the storm's actual trajectory. It’s important to remember that the cone doesn’t represent the size of the hurricane. A hurricane can have a large wind field extending far beyond the cone. The cone also doesn’t indicate the area that will be affected by hurricane-force winds or other hazards such as storm surge or heavy rainfall. The cone shows where the center of the storm might go. Therefore, people outside of the cone are still at risk from the effects of the hurricane. The areas along and adjacent to the projected path within the cone have the highest risk of experiencing the direct impacts of the storm. The areas outside of the cone can also be affected, though usually with lesser impacts like heavy rain, strong winds, and flooding. So, don’t just focus on the cone; pay attention to the specific hazards predicted for your area, even if you are outside of the cone. When authorities issue warnings or evacuation orders, they take all these factors into account. Always follow the instructions from local emergency management officials and be prepared for potential changes in the storm’s track.

Factors Influencing Hurricane Isaac's Trajectory

Several factors play crucial roles in shaping the Hurricane Isaac's path. Understanding these influences helps us better anticipate where the storm might go and what impacts it might bring. Let's break down the main elements at play:

Steering Currents

The primary driver of a hurricane's movement is the steering currents in the atmosphere. These are large-scale wind patterns that act like a river, carrying the hurricane along with them. The direction and speed of these steering currents have a significant impact on the storm’s path. High-pressure systems, low-pressure systems, and troughs in the atmosphere can all influence these steering currents. For example, if a hurricane is caught in a persistent easterly flow, it might move westward. If it encounters a trough, the storm could turn northward or even northeastward. These currents can change over time, and that's why hurricane forecasts can change as well. The intensity of a storm can also play a role, as stronger storms can sometimes influence the steering currents around them, making them more resilient to changes in the atmosphere.

Sea Surface Temperatures

Sea surface temperatures (SSTs) are another critical factor. Hurricanes gain energy from warm ocean waters. The warmer the water, the more fuel the hurricane has to maintain its strength. As a hurricane moves over cooler waters, it tends to weaken. The SSTs help determine the storm's intensity and also can affect its path. For example, if a hurricane is moving toward an area of cooler water, it might weaken and change its course. Therefore, areas with consistently warm ocean temperatures, like the Gulf of Mexico, can be conducive to hurricane development and sustainment. Changes in SST can also influence how quickly a hurricane intensifies or weakens. A sudden decrease in SST can cause rapid weakening, whereas consistently warm waters can lead to strengthening. These changes can, in turn, affect the projected path of the hurricane.

Atmospheric Stability

The stability of the atmosphere also matters. An unstable atmosphere – where warm, moist air near the surface rises readily – supports the development and intensification of hurricanes. Stable conditions, where air resists rising, can inhibit storm development and even weaken a storm. Wind shear, the change in wind speed and direction with height, is another crucial factor. High wind shear can disrupt the organization of a hurricane, potentially weakening it or causing it to change its path. Hurricanes need a relatively low-shear environment to maintain their structure. High wind shear can tilt the storm's vertical structure, disrupting the circulation and preventing it from developing fully. Meteorologists constantly monitor these conditions to refine their forecast of Hurricane Isaac's path. They use weather models, satellite data, and aircraft observations to analyze these factors and predict the storm's future behavior.

Staying Informed About Hurricane Isaac's Path

Staying informed about the Hurricane Isaac's path and potential impacts is crucial for your safety and the safety of your loved ones. Here's a comprehensive guide to the best resources and practices for staying updated:

Official Sources for Information

The National Hurricane Center (NHC) is the primary source for official hurricane forecasts, advisories, and warnings. Check their website regularly for the latest information on the storm's track, intensity, and potential impacts. The NHC provides detailed forecasts, including the cone of uncertainty, wind probabilities, and rainfall estimates. Local National Weather Service (NWS) offices also offer localized information, including forecasts and warnings specific to your area. These local offices often provide more detailed information tailored to your community. Emergency management agencies at the state and local levels are another critical source. These agencies coordinate preparedness efforts and issue evacuation orders. They can provide essential information about potential risks and safety measures in your specific area. Also, check with your local government's website or social media channels for updates. These sources often share information about shelter locations, evacuation routes, and other important details.

Reliable Media Outlets

Choose reputable media outlets for your news. Look for media outlets with experienced meteorologists who provide accurate and understandable information. TV news channels, radio stations, and online news sites with dedicated weather teams can provide timely updates and expert analysis. Make sure to rely on the weather information provided by your local media as well. These sources often have local meteorologists who can provide a more tailored forecast based on the local weather conditions. Be wary of unverified information and social media rumors. Stick to official sources and credible media outlets to avoid misinformation. Social media can be useful for getting alerts and staying in touch with your community, but always verify information before taking action.

Personal Preparedness Measures

Develop a hurricane preparedness plan early in the season. Know your evacuation routes and have a plan for where you will go if you are ordered to evacuate. Prepare a disaster supply kit that includes essential items like water, non-perishable food, first-aid supplies, medications, flashlights, batteries, and a battery-powered or hand-crank radio. Stay informed about the storm’s progress and potential impacts. Regularly monitor official sources for updates and be ready to adapt to changing forecasts. Secure your home. Bring loose objects inside or tie them down to prevent them from becoming projectiles in high winds. Trim trees and shrubs around your home to reduce the risk of damage. Protect windows and doors with shutters or plywood. Ensure you have adequate insurance coverage for your home and belongings. Flood insurance is especially important if you live in a flood-prone area, as standard homeowner's insurance typically doesn't cover flood damage. Listen to and follow the instructions of local authorities. If you are asked to evacuate, do so promptly. Safety is always the top priority.

Potential Impacts Along Hurricane Isaac's Path

The Hurricane Isaac's path will directly affect certain areas, and it's essential to understand the potential impacts. Here's a breakdown of the key hazards:

Strong Winds

High winds are a significant threat. Hurricane-force winds can cause significant damage to buildings, power lines, and trees. These winds can also create dangerous conditions for travel and outdoor activities. Stay indoors during high winds, and avoid going outside unless absolutely necessary. Secure loose objects around your home and property to prevent them from becoming projectiles. The effects of the wind depend on the storm's intensity and the distance from the storm's center. Areas near the center will experience the strongest winds, while areas further away will experience weaker but still potentially damaging winds. Always stay informed about the expected wind speeds in your area.

Storm Surge

Storm surge is the abnormal rise in seawater levels during a hurricane. It is often the deadliest hazard associated with hurricanes. Storm surge can cause widespread flooding and coastal erosion. The extent of the storm surge depends on the storm's intensity, size, forward speed, and the shape of the coastline. Low-lying coastal areas are particularly vulnerable to storm surge. Evacuate if you are in a storm surge-prone area. Follow the instructions of local authorities and seek higher ground. Never drive through floodwaters, as they can be deeper and more dangerous than they appear.

Heavy Rainfall and Flooding

Hurricanes bring heavy rainfall, which can lead to flooding. Flooding can occur inland, even far from the coast. Excessive rainfall can overwhelm drainage systems and cause rivers and streams to overflow. Flash floods can develop quickly and pose a significant threat. Avoid driving or walking through flooded areas. Monitor local weather forecasts and flood warnings. Be prepared to evacuate if your home is in a flood-prone area. Have a plan for how you will deal with flooding, including knowing your elevation and potential escape routes.

Tornadoes

Hurricanes can also spawn tornadoes. These tornadoes can occur within the hurricane's rain bands, even far from the storm’s center. Tornadoes associated with hurricanes can be particularly dangerous. Stay informed about tornado watches and warnings issued by the NWS. Seek shelter immediately if a tornado warning is issued for your area. The safest place to shelter is in an interior room on the lowest floor of a sturdy building.
